Thrilled by Madness (Completed Main Story) - Chapter 107
Won Hoo left work and went straight to Do Soon’s house.
So enchanted by Yeo Do Soon’s bold charm that he could no longer give up evenings spent with her, he chuckled softly while eating the ramen she’d made for him.
He found himself oddly amused by how excited he’d been just the other night, when Do Soon had told him to abandon everything and come to her.
As he ate, Won Hoo thought realistically.
Even if his father withdrew all the massive funds invested in CN, it was still a problem he could easily recover from. He might face some difficulties along the way, but those very hardships had shaped who he was today.
Yet this woman saw him as someone she had to take care of at all costs—feed him, clothe him, put him to bed, and even promised to start a new company for him someday, no matter how long it took. She insisted he just come to her, empty-handed, even if he became unemployed.
He’d never met a woman like her in his life—but she was precisely the kind he never wanted to lose. Did it even make sense to push Yeo Do Soon away just because she’d once liked his friend? No, he couldn’t do that anymore. He couldn’t even imagine a life without her now.
Since things had come to this, today was the day he had to honestly lay bare his worries to her. Only then could he draw closer to Yeo Do Soon.
After much deliberation, Won Hoo opened his mouth just as he chewed and swallowed the last noodle.
“I have something to say.”
“Just say it—why build up suspense like that? You’re making my heart flutter for no reason.”
Do Soon replied as she carried her empty ramen bowl to the sink. Won Hoo then spoke his mind plainly.
“I used to like Ms. Eom So Yeon. I’m not sure if someone like me even deserves to desire you, Ms. Yeo Do Soon.”
“So, are you saying I was just second best—a chicken in place of a pheasant?”
“No. I did have strong feelings for Ms. Eom So Yeon, but after meeting you, Ms. Yeo Do Soon, I realized it was just infatuation.”
